German term or phrase: BUT-NR
This occurs in the heading of a German bank statement from a building loan contract. The heading itself is a list. The list is as follows:

Buchungsdatum / Betrag in EUR / Buchungsvorgang Prämienwirksam / Wert Gültigkeitsjahr / BWZ-Korr. / Fundstelle / BUT-NR / GV-Nr.

I do not have any idea what BUT-NR might stand for. Any help is appreciated.
